Title: stryker (cart edition)
Post by: arnoldemu on 14:01, 07 October 13
Hi All,

Attached is Stryker and the Crypts of Trogan converted to cartridge.

I used my cart filing system.

This conversion was hard work but I did it.

My changes:
- when the title screen appears, there is a timeout, or you can press "fire" (space or either digital joystick button) to continue
- in menu you can use keyboard or joystick to switch fx/music. pause is not used here so no clash over P!
- in game you can control the menu through q,a,o,p and space (with H to pause) OR either digital joystick (with P to pause). The control method is decided on if you press space or joystick fire.

The game was harder to convert because:
1. It has a built in checksum test (it does a checksum and reports a "load error") so patching the game was more difficult.
2. Stryker loads on 64K or 128K and has extras for 128k (same as on tape). So if you run on gx4000 you will have 64k game, if you run on 6128+ you can have 128K game. So this is a cart that uses the extra 128k :)
3. I had to check both 64k and 128k versions, and on some screens the inputs change a little.
4. There isn't any extra room to patch in anything new (no other plus features could be used). I had just enough space (where the keyboard reading code is) to patch in code to enable a cart page, jump to the cart, do some work (plenty of space left in cart to do work) and then jump back. I put pause check, control scan, and menu control code here. Very little ram space to do other patching :(

I hope I didn't introduce any new bugs, I tested quite a lot.

Hope you like it.

If I patch another game to cart, I'll try to add a bit more features.

Post by: Phantomz on 21:48, 01 August 18
I've just updated this version by @arnoldemu (http://www.cpcwiki.eu/forum/index.php?action=profile;u=122)

You can now use UP or Joypad 1 Button 2 to Jump , like in the PLUS version of Switch Blade.

No other changes have been made, so this is to be used on a PLUS computer or you will get stuck on the highscore table.

Use the version I did for the GX4000 for the console.  ;)
